Great mid range earphones
So i got these to replace my anker semi-wireless earphones as i wanted something totally wire free.The product comes nicely packed, with a nice carry bag, 3-4 different earphone sizes and a charging cable (albeit a small one so that it fits in). The case is nice, its a good size and light and looks good. My only very mild quite nit-picky opinion is that it would be nicer to look at/nicer feeling if it was aluminium like their other products and that the case could be a little easier to open without nails.Paring, dead easy took them out find them on device and connected, piece of cake, 10/10 for ease of use here. This was done on a Sony Xperia XA Ultra which has Bluetooth 4.1. Considering this is a terrible phone that requires you to choose between wifi or bluetooth and runs slower than a tortoise dragging an anchor, i expected more issues.Sound quality is good, i'd say the quality is equal to my Anker ones however the bass on these are superior, but the volume wont go up quite as high (my ears probably thankful for that). These are the quality you'd expect from mid-range wireless earphones.Battery life is a 2 part question really. The case has a 3000 mAh battery in it, which is alot for a headphone case. This battery will last a very long time. The fact you can use it as a powerbank is very cool imho and whilst i've not tried it, will be very helpful in a pinch. A 3000mAh battery is enough to give the average smartphone 2 full charges give or take. Because of this you can charge the headphones for a very long time without the need to charge the case.When it comes to playtime on the earphones i have to admit i was a little disappointed; i started listening to music at 08:40 and i got a low battery warning at 13:40. That's 5 hours non-stop play time on very low volume. I shouldent complain really, these are very small devices with a tiny battery in them and 5 hours is a lot but it wont get me though a full days work without a charge, i was hoping to get about 7 hours out of them but this is only a small set back really.The real magic for me on these devices is actually something i glossed over thinking i would not use, the touch buttons. They are very intuitive and work really well. I have a Fenix 5+ smart watch and have always used this to skip track/change volume etc however i actually find myself using the tap options to alter volume/pause/skip track etc over my watch now, it works really well.When watching a youtube video i found very slight sound delay, which seemed to improve over the course of a few minutes. I cannot rate the product on this as i have not tried it on a Bluetooth 5 device which may alleviate that issue entirely.The microphone is passable on these, which is actually a miracle considering its just a tiny hole dug into the ear im surprised people could hear me at all. My dad struggled to hear me on the phone, then again he struggles to hear me when i'm shouting down his ear so this was an invalid test. My girlfriend said there was a little background noise however i was clear and audible which gives a thumbs up to these as a wireless phonecall device. The microphone is not as good as airpods; that said, the airpods are just a transportation device for its own massive microphone so that's to be expected, and these are a fraction of the cost.These are extremely comfortable in the ear, and can often be forgotten they are there yet they stay in the ear beautifully. The noise cancellation is very good, even with music off and both in people need to raise their voice substantially for me to hear.When charging, little red lights show up on each ear piece and disapear when fully charged. There is a 3 stage blue LED on the case its-self to show how much charge is left in the case. This will show when charging the earphones and/or the case.To test the water resistance i left them in the sink overnight..........Ok not tested that.Overall; great device easy to setup works well good sound quality good mic and stylish. If you are looking for mid range earphones that look good look no further :).-EDIT-After 9 months of use i have to point out something that is annoying enough for me to drop a star. When placing these buds back in the charging case despite the magnetic click in feature they never quite go in properly and turn off. I come home i drop them in and later on when i get a phone call, i realise i cant hear the person because its still connected to the earbuds by the front door in the case as they didn't disengage properly. Instead; you have to put these in the case and wiggle them around a bit to visibly take note of the light changing from blue to red to ensure they have switched off. Sometimes you push the bottom a bit it goes red and when you let go it goes back to blue and re-pairs with the phone. These are still a great product however something to consider.--UPDATE Feb 2020--So I've upgraded to top of the range Sennheiser Momentums, which give me a good comparison for these.My new ones sound better than these, however that's a totally unfair comparison to make given the price gap. What the new ones have shown me is how good the sound quality of these are for a much cheaper alternative. You could not ask for more in the way of sound.Having independent earbuds is also a point to these buds, my others have to have the right bud out which is actually a big problem for me when listening at work. The battery life on these is also vastly superior and the ability to charge a phone etc via the case is a neat little addition which i have made a lot of use of especially when travelling.The reason I've dropped this to 3 stars is for 2 issues, even tho the pros outweigh the cons i feel these 2 issues are irritating enough for the lower stars.1. Auto paring. When i leave work i take these out of the case to listen to music. Sometimes; they just work, 50% of the time one bud will connect and 1 wont. Then i have to turn the other bud off and on, and that bud will connect, disconnecting the other bud. At this point i need to put both back in the case and take them out again and hope for the better side of the 50% to kick in. Sometimes i can be half way home before I've gotten these to pair.2. Charging the buds. When putting them back in the case its not enough to just let the magnet snap them in, you gotta keep twisting them slightly until the red light comes on to charge, or they stay on. At random times they will ever-so-slightly disconnect from the charging pins in the case, causing them to pair to my phone, so when i get a call or put a video/music on i suddenly cant hear because its going through my buds, in the case; by the front door. This is extremely irritating and resulted in me having to unpair the buds every day when i come home, which made them impractical thus the new earbuds i just purchased.
